Shell plc Form 6-K Summary
Business Context and Reporting Period
This Form 6-K, filed on June 8, 2022, reports a series of transactions in Shell plc's own shares conducted during May 2022. The filing details daily share repurchases executed for cancellation under the company's share buy-back arrangement. The transactions were carried out in compliance with the UK Market Abuse Regulation (UK MAR) and EU Market Abuse Regulation (EU MAR).
Key Financial Metrics
The filing does not provide consolidated revenue, profit, cash flow, or debt metrics. It focuses exclusively on share repurchase activity. Key metrics from the reported period include:
- Reporting Period: May 4, 2022, through May 31, 2022.
- Transaction Type: Share buy-backs for cancellation.
- Trading Venues: London Stock Exchange (LSE), Chi-X (CXE), and BATS (BXE).
- Price Range (GBP): The volume-weighted average price per share ranged from approximately £22.27 to £24.08 during the period.
- Trading Agents: Citigroup Global Markets Limited (May 4) and BNP Paribas Exane (May 5–31).
Material Changes and Activity
The filing documents a consistent and significant volume of share repurchases throughout May 2022. Daily purchases generally ranged between 3.5 million and 4.0 million shares across all venues combined. The share price trended upward during the month, with the volume-weighted average price increasing from roughly £22.34 on May 4 to approximately £24.08 by May 31. These purchases were executed under pre-set parameters within the authority granted for the buy-back program.
Guidance, Outlook, and Risks
The filing contains no forward-looking guidance, management commentary on operational outlook, or discussion of specific risks and contingencies. The document is a regulatory disclosure of completed transactions. It notes that trading decisions were made independently by the appointed agents (Citigroup and BNP Paribas Exane) within the framework of the buy-back arrangement announced on February 3, 2022, and May 5, 2022.
